CPU comparisonMediaTek Dimensity 6080 or AMD 3020e -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.
The MediaTek Dimensity 6080 has 8 cores with 8 threads and clocks with a maximum frequency of 2.40 GHz. Up to 12 GB of memory is supported in 2 memory channels. The MediaTek Dimensity 6080 was released in Q1/2023. The AMD 3020e has 2 cores with 4 threads and clocks with a maximum frequency of 2.60 GHz. The CPU supports up to 32 GB of memory in 2 memory channels. The AMD 3020e was released in Q1/2020. |

Memory & PCIeThe MediaTek Dimensity 6080 can use up to 12 GB of memory in 2 memory channels. The maximum memory bandwidth is 17.1 GB/s. The AMD 3020e supports up to 32 GB of memory in 2 memory channels and achieves a memory bandwidth of up to 38.4 GB/s. |
